    @LindaB, my husband, me and our 2 boys aged 10 &11 at the time did 6 weeks, 21 or 25 states(can't remember) and 10,000 miles in our t@b 2 years ago. That's as close to full timing it as you can get without permanently doing it. The ziplock bags are great. They change shape to fit in nooks and crannies. I  use the freezer type because of the added strength. I double bag liquids like spaghetti sauce, soups or stews when I prepared food in bulk cooking sessions, which helped us spend more time in national parks and sightseeing.     Not for full timing but what we do is cook before we go camping or traveling and use our food saver. I love that thing. I often portion soup by freezing in a serving size square Tupperware, then popping it out and Food Savering it. The bags can be washed if you are concerned about spending or waste. I do sometimes unless it’s raw meat.
